An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Systems Engineering Manager (SEM) within Thales Optronics and Missile Electronics (OME). The successful candidate will initially undertake the role of Systems Engineering Manager within the Sea business.
As a SEM you will work in collaboration with the Head of Systems Engineering and the Senior Engineering Delivery Manager for Sea.
The successful candidate will have a strong background in Systems Engineering with experience in team management and leading the delivery of work packages. They will be highly business focused with excellent communication skills and have the ability to work in fast moving environments with multiple parallel objectives. Knowledge and experience of Sea products is essential to this role.
This role will work closely with the Head of Systems Engineering and the Senior Engineering Delivery Manager for Sea. This role will report to both the Head of Systems Engineering and the Sea Sector Senior Engineering Delivery Manager.

Due to the nature of the work that we do at Thales, many of our roles are subject to security restrictions. This role requires Security Clearance (SC). It would be advantageous if currently held, however, if not currently held, it is a requirement that the successful applicant undergo, achieve, and maintain SC Clearance prior to commencing employment.
To be eligible for full SC, you generally need to have resided in the UK for the last 5 years. In some circumstances, a minimum of 3 years’ residence in the UK over the last 5 years may be accepted, with additional overseas checks.
